Grizzlies edge Pelicans 107-104 led by Morant, Bane
In a closely contested game, the Memphis Grizzlies defeated the New Orleans Pelicans 107-104, thanks to standout performances from Ja Morant and Desmond Bane, who scored 32 and 30 points respectively. Morant also contributed six assists and three steals, while Bane added nine rebounds and eight assists. The Grizzlies overcame a halftime deficit of 64-57, with Morant's jump shot giving them the lead for good late in the fourth quarter. The Pelicans' Trey Murphy III scored 27 points, but missed attempts at the end prevented them from tying the game. Memphis controlled the boards, outrebounding New Orleans 57 to 39, and will face the Phoenix Suns next. The Pelicans are set to play against the Los Angeles Clippers on Tuesday night.
